UNITED KINGDOM. Victoria, 1837-1901.
Gold sovereign, 1845. London. Spread 4 5.
First young head of Victoria facing left, hair tied in fillet; date below truncation, with 4 5 widely spaced; VICTORIA DEI GRATIA. / Crowned shield within wreath; thistle, rose and shamrock below; BRITANNIARUM REGINA FID: DEF:.
Ex. Ezen collection on PCGS label.
In secure plastic holder, graded PCGS AU53 , certification number 30827493.
PCGS population in this grade: 6.
PCGS population in higher grade: 40.
Reference: Fr-387e; KM-736.1; Marsh-28; S-3852
Mintage: 3,800,845.
Diameter: 22.05 mm.
Weight: 7.9881 g. (AGW=0.2355 oz.)
Composition: 917.0/1000 Gold.
